Based in Thailand, Ruthie serves alongside a Bible translation project, creating culturally and theologically contextualized illustrations to accompany the newly translated Biblical text. It is her joy to illustrate Bible stories in a way that allows people to see themselves in Scripture and understand how Jesus deeply loves their specific people group.
